Abstract:
This paper aimed to investigate the nonclassical size dependent free vibration behavior of regularly squared cutout viscoelastic nanobeams nanobeams. The nonlocal strain gradient elasticity theory is modified and adopted to incorporate the viscoelasticity effecteffect. The Kelvin Voigt viscoelastic model is adopted to model the linear viscoelastic constitutive response response. To explore the influence of shear defo rmation effect due to cutout cutout, both Euler Bernoulli and Timoshenko beams theories are considered considered. The Hamilton principle is utilized to derive the dynamic equations of motion incorporating viscoelasticity and size dependent eff ectsects. Closed form solutions fo r the resonant frequencies for both perforated Euler Bernoulli nanobeams (PEBNB) and perforated Timoshenko nanobeams (PTNB) are derived considering different boundary conditions conditions. The developed procedure is verified by comparing the obtained results with th e available results in the literature literature. Parametric studies are conducted to show the influence of the material damping damping, the perforation perforation, the material and the geometrical parameters as well as the boundary and loading conditions on the dynamic behavior of vi scoelastic perforated nanobeams nanobeams. The proposed procedure and the obtained results are supportive in the analysis and design of perforated viscoelastic NEMS structures structures.
